On April 21, 1999, your application for a 401 Water Quality Certification for the
Somerset Plantation HOA in Carteret County was received by the N.C. Division of Water
Quality. The Division will begin to review the project for eventual decision. However,
please be aware that beginning January 1, 1999 that the N.C. General Assembly passed
legislation requiring payment of a fee of $200.00 for this project. Please note, this fee is
not included in the payment made to the Division of Coastal Management. The 401
Certification cannot be issued until this fee is paid. Until that time, your application will
remain on hold as incomplete.

The following are my comments and recommendations regarding the above
mentioned project.
Due to the lack of resources within the area immediately adjacent to the existing
bulkhead within the project area, I have no objections to the proposal contingent
upon the following conditions:
1) The riprap will not extend waterward more than 10' from the existing bulkhead
at its base.
2) The riprap material must be free from loose dirt or any other pollutant. It must
be of a size sufficient to prevent its movement from the site by wave or current
action.
3) The riprap material must consist of clean rock or masonry materials such as,
but not limited to, granite or broken concrete. Materials such as tires, car bodies,
scrap metal, paper products, tree limbs, wood debris, organic material or similar
material, are not considered riprap.
